
Traders have finally been allowed entry to go about their normal businesses at the Lagos International Trade Fair, few hours after it was shut down.
The Trade Fair, according to some traders who were sen protesting at the premisses, was shut with no reason given to them. Some of them carried placards and chanted songs like, “we no go gree o.”
Traders who were unaware of the development arrived their shops at the Trade Fair in the early morning of Monday, 18th of March, 2019 for their normal businesses only to discover to their surprise that all the gates leading to the Fair had been shut.

Meanwhile, while some of the traders said the premises had just been opened while no explanation was given as to the reason for the initial closure, others claimed the premises was shut because a particular major political party was holding its rally in the premises.
